Sam Landstrom has been a technical writer for Microsoft for several years, having written hundreds of online articles teaching software development. Previously, he programmed robots for a DNA sequencing laboratory at the University of Washington that contributed to the Human Genome Project, among other genome sequencing projects.
In his free time, Sam enjoys writing (of course), listening to audio books while doing errands (e.g. walking the dogs), playing Dungeons and Dragons with his co-workers, and hanging out with his wife and two kids in the Seattle area.
MetaGame is Sam's first novel. He thinks that writing fiction is great fun and is working on other novels now.
